Opening Land in Nelson Land District for Sale or Selection.
CHARLES FERGUSSON, Governor-General.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ers and authorities
conferred upon me by the Land Act, 1924, I, General
Sir Charles Fergusson, Baronet, Governor-General of the
Dominion of New Zealand, do hereby declare and provide
as follows, that is to say:-
-
The rural land enumerated in the Schedule hereto is
hereby set apart for disposal by way of sale or selection on
Tuesday, the eighth day of December, one thousand nine
hundred and twenty-five, at the respective price specified
in the said Schedule, and shall be deemed to be "heavy-bush
land." -
The said land may be purchased for cash, or be selected
for occupation with right of purchase, or on renewable lease. -
After the first half-year's rent has been paid by the
selector the further instalments of rent payable by him for a
period of three years shall not be demanded ; provided that
if at any time during the first five years of his occupancy the
selector disposes of his interest in the land, the rent so con-
ceded shall be paid by him in full, and thereupon the Land
Board may remit such instalments of rent payable by the
incoming tenant, not exceeding in the aggregate the amount
of rent previously conceded to the selector, as the Board
shall think fit.
SCHEDULE.
NELSON LAND DISTRICT.-SECOND-CLASS LAND.
Waimea County.-Wai-iti Survey District.
(Exempt from Rent for Three Years.)
SECTIONS 4, 5, and 6, Block X : Area, 853 acres l rood 37
perches. Capital value, £535. Occupation with right of
purchase : Half-yearly rent, £13 7s. 6d. Renewable lease:
Half-yearly rent, £10 14s.
Situated in Pretty Bridge Valley, five miles and a half
from Belgrove Railway-station by formed and metalled road
for three miles, thence unmetalled road. Sections comprise
about one hundred acres of fern country, the balance being
cut-out milling-bush. There is a considerable amount of
fencing and firewood material on these sections. The soil
is generally of a poor quality. Well watered. Altitude,
700 ft. to 1,700 ft. above sea-level.
As witness the hand of His Excellency the Governor-General,
this 27th day of October, 1925.
F. H. D. BELL, for Minister of Lands.

Vesting the Control of a Scenic Reserve in the Taumarunui
Borough Council.
CHARLES FERGUSSON, Governor-General.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ers and authorities
conferred upon him by section thirteen of the Scenery
Preservation Act, 1908 (hereinafter referred to as "the said
Act"), His Excellency the Governor-General of the Dominion
of New Zealand doth hereby vest the control of the scenic
reserve described in the Schedule hereto (being land reserved
under the said Act) in the Taumarunui Borough Council,
subject to the conditions hereinafter contained, that is to
say :-
-
The period for which the control of the reserve is hereby
vested shall be three years from the date hereof, unless the
reservation is previously altered or revoked under the said
Act. -
The said Council shall prepare a report each year ending
on the thirty-first day of March, together with a statement of
receipts and expenditure in connection with the said reserve.
Such report and statement shall be sent to the Minister
charged with the administration of the said Act as soon as
possible after the close of the year. -
The said Council shall control the said reserve in accord-
ance with the provisions of the said Act and of the regulations
made thereunder.
SCHEDULE.
ALL that area in the Wellington Land District, containing
by admeasurement 24 acres 2 roods 30 perches, more or less,
being Lot A, Block J, Hunua Survey District. As the same
is delineated on a plan marked L. and S. l/440, deposited
in the Head Office, Department of Lands and Survey, at
Wellington, and thereon coloured red.
As witness the hand of His Excellency the Governor-
General, this 27th day of October, 1925.
F. H. D. BELL,
For Minister in Charge of Scenery Preservation.
